随着信息技术的迅猛发展,软件作为支撑各种业务运作的核心工具,其安全性问题日益受到广泛关注。软件评测作为保障软件质量的重要手段,其中安全性评估更是不可缺少的一环。
一、安全性评估的重要性
安全性评估是软件评测的核心内容之一,其主要目的是识别软件中存在的安全漏洞和潜在风险,并评估其对系统安全的影响程度。通过安全性评估,可以有效预防数据泄露、系统被攻击等安全事件的发生,保障用户信息安全和系统稳定运行。
二、安全性评估的主要方法
1.静态代码分析。
安全性评估的方法是什么
静态代码分析是安全性评估的一种重要方法,通过对源代码进行自动扫描和分析,检测代码中存在的安全漏洞和缺陷。这种方法可以在软件开发的早期阶段就发现潜在的安全问题,从而及时修复,避免漏洞被利用。
2.动态渗透测试。
动态渗透测试是模拟黑客攻击行为,对软件系统进行实际攻击,以检测其安全防御能力的一种方法。通过渗透测试,可以发现系统在实际运行中的安全漏洞和弱点,从而采取相应措施进行加固。
3.安全漏洞扫描。
安全漏洞扫描是利用自动化工具对软件系统进行全面扫描,发现已知的安全漏洞和潜在风险。这种方法可以快速发现系统中的安全问题,并提供相应的修复建议。
4.安全配置审查。
安全配置审查是对软件系统的安全配置进行检查和评估,以确保系统配置符合安全标准和实践。通过审查配置文件、安全策略等,可以发现配置不当导致的安全风险,并及时进行整改。